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Alder leaf beetle | Bishop'S-Cap |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Animalia (Animals)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) |
| Order | Coleoptera (Beetles) | Saxifragales (Saxifragales) |
| Family | Chrysomelidae | Saxifragaceae |
| Genus | Agelastica | Mitella |
| Species | Agelastica alni | Mitella diphylla |
